The Blair County Suicide Prevention Task Force was established in October 2004 under the auspices of the Blair County Mental Health Office. The task force consists of representatives from various entities with the mission of stopping suicide in Blair County.
Training for school and medical personnel
Parent education
Student education
Yellow Ribbon Campaign
Signs of Suicide Program
Substance abuse prevention
Implemented a fall suicide awareness campaign in 2008 and will continue to work on community awareness throughout the year. Through the Student Assistance Program, conduct a summer suicide support group for youth who have lost a loved one due to suicide.

Prevent Suicide PA is a 501(c)3 nonprofit organization. Since the 1980/90’s, Pennsylvania has made strong efforts to prevent suicide through various programs and non-profits throughout the Commonwealth. A work group was formed and began to meet in July 2005. This prevention plan is a collaborative effort between those dedicated individuals from both the public and private sectors of our state.
